    This mod was planned a year ago according to my Amazon purchase history.
    This is the type of LED pods I purchased and I used a "T" tap into the puddle light wire so I could disconnect if I remove the door panel again.

    Here's my logic (or maybe i'm justifying lol) but if i plan to go into the woods exploring, i expect to bust some shit on my truck. The lesson i learned in this case is, power isn't always a good thing. Sometimes you need to tippytoe through something and winch it out rather than just plowing through it.
